Summary
The segment reports on the identification and federal charges against 19-year-old Ohio man Tycen Proper for allegedly plotting an attack on the UFC fight at the White House. It details the mother's tip leading to the investigation, discovery of firearms and Signal chat plans involving drones and snipers, the group's name and motivations, and involvement of multiple suspects.
Reporting draws from newly unsealed court records and statements by FBI Director Kash Patel; notes Secret Service cooperation and Trump's comments from the G7 summit in France that he had not been briefed.
Editorial Assessment
The broadcast accurately conveys the main elements of the FBI affidavit and complaint as reported across outlets. Viewer misses nuance that Patel's social media post preceded full arrests and drew internal criticism for potentially compromising the operation. No counter-evidence or defense perspective is presented, but the story is narrowly focused on the disruption of an alleged plot. Framing is neutral and fact-based.
Key Moments
19-year-old Tyson/Tycen Proper faces federal charges of conspiracy, attempted murder of US officer, and firearm offenses for UFC White House plot
Court complaint and multiple news reports confirm charges against Tycen Proper
Mother tipped off local police about son's online activity and firearm purchases days before the event
FBI affidavit details the June 10 tip and subsequent search
Signal chats outlined drone detonations, snipers, and plans by group Vanguard of the Old
Affidavit and reporting from AP, BBC, and local outlets corroborate details and group name
Multiple individuals arrested; FBI Director Kash Patel stated the plot was stopped cold
Patel's X post and DOJ statements confirm at least five in custody
Trump said he had not been briefed while at G7 in France
Consistent with contemporaneous reporting on the event
